Mountain biking around Herbetswil offers a diverse landscape characterized by rolling hills, dense forests, and significant elevation changes. The region features numerous loop trails that navigate through varied terrain, including open meadows and shaded woodland paths. Mountain bikers can expect challenging climbs and rewarding descents, with routes often leading to scenic viewpoints. The area's topography provides a natural playground for those seeking an active outdoor experience on two wheels.

There are over 340 mountain bike trails around Herbetswil, offering a wide range of options for different skill levels. This includes 38 easy, 180 moderate, and 131 difficult routes.
Yes, Herbetswil offers 38 easy mountain bike trails. These routes typically feature less challenging terrain and elevation changes, making them ideal for beginners or those looking for a more relaxed ride. You can find detailed information on individual easy routes on komoot.
The region around Herbetswil is characterized by rolling hills, dense forests, and significant elevation changes. You'll encounter varied terrain, including open meadows, shaded woodland paths, challenging climbs, and rewarding descents. Many routes are loop trails, navigating through this diverse landscape.
Yes, Herbetswil has a substantial selection of moderate mountain bike trails, with 180 routes available. A good example is the Hintere Schmiedenmatt – View of Hallchopf loop from Herbetswil, which is 11.4 miles (18.4 km) long and offers a balanced challenge. Another moderate option is the Schmiedenmatt loop from Aedermannsdorf, covering 7.3 miles (11.8 km).
The mountain bike trails around Herbetswil are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.5 stars from over 1200 reviews. Mountain bikers often praise the diverse landscapes, challenging climbs, and scenic viewpoints that define the region's routes.
Yes, some mountain bike routes in the area can lead you near natural attractions. For example, the Verenaschlucht and Hermitage is a notable gorge that features both waterfall and cave elements. Other highlights include the Waterfall in Gore Virat and the Bäreloch Cave.
For experienced riders, Herbetswil offers 131 difficult mountain bike trails. Popular challenging routes include the Weissenstein Spa Hotel – Hinterweissenstein loop from Aedermannsdorf, a 27.4 miles (44.0 km) trail with significant elevation gain, and the Mieschegg – Obere Tannmatt mountain inn loop from Aedermannsdorf, a 24.7 miles (39.8 km) path offering panoramic views.
Yes, many mountain bike trails around Herbetswil are designed as loop routes, allowing you to start and finish in the same location. The Höngen Fountain – Leisiweiher loop from Aedermannsdorf is a 24.9 miles (40.1 km) loop through forested hills and past water features, often completed in about 3 hours 19 minutes.
Trail durations vary significantly based on difficulty and length. For example, a difficult route like the Weissenstein Spa Hotel – Hinterweissenstein loop from Aedermannsdorf typically takes around 3 hours 43 minutes, while a moderate trail like the Hintere Schmiedenmatt – View of Hallchopf loop from Herbetswil can be completed in about 2 hours.
Yes, some trails in the Herbetswil region offer the reward of mountain inns or scenic viewpoints. The Mieschegg – Obere Tannmatt mountain inn loop from Aedermannsdorf is a difficult path that passes by a mountain inn, providing a perfect spot for a break and refreshments.
